Art as diplomacy

Art as diplomacy refers to using art—such as exhibitions, cultural exchanges, and collaborations—as a means to foster international understanding and relationships. It transcends language barriers, showcasing shared values, histories, and creativity, which can build trust and dialogue between nations. Rather than relying solely on political negotiations, art diplomacy promotes peaceful engagement, mutual respect, and cultural appreciation, helping to bridge differences and create connections in a more personal and impactful way. It highlights that creativity and cultural expression are powerful tools for fostering global cooperation and goodwill.
